Re: Inevitable by Mhalachai - Xenoproctologist - 03-17-2006 Title: Inevitable Author: Mhalachai URL: www.tthfanfic.org/Story-6...itable.htm Fandom: Harry Potter / Anita Blake crossover. Setting: One year after Incubus Dreams (not Micah-compliant) / One year after Order of the Phoenix (not Half-Blood Prince-compliant) Summary: A late-night run-in with werewolves in the woods outside St. Louis dumps Harry Potter into a whole new world of trouble. Now Anita Blake has to deal with a new charge as well as Death-Eaters come to town. Well written. In character. Manages to mesh the two universes (or, at least, convincingly sidestep any issues). Stays true to the POV conventions of both series without becoming a total POV-clusterfuck (halle-fucking-lujah). Frequently updated (averaging an update per week for a little over a year). And, most importantly, approaching biblical in length at over 300,000 words, to date (okay...half a bible, anyway). Re: The Birthday Present - Custos Sophiae - 04-13-2006 This is a Potter story, started before HBP was published. Harry has a good summer with the Dursleys thanks to Petunia slipping everyone a potion, Snape gives Harry a pensieve full of unpleasant memories for a birthday present, and someone dies. It's pro-Snape, but all the characters are fairly sympathetically drawn - fundamentally decent, but humanly fallible - apart from Voldemort and Vernon. The plot has a nice mix of intrigue, action, and quiet moments. The author says they have an 800 page first draft of the story, which is being expanded as they release it, so it's likely to be completed. It doesn't look like it's at the half-way point yet.
